What Composite Bonding Actually Is
Composite bonding is a cosmetic dental treatment where a tooth-colored resin is applied to the surface of your teeth to fix small imperfections.
It’s painless, requires little to no drilling, and can often be done in a single appointment.
Because it’s a very gentle procedure, many patients choose it when they want noticeable improvements without committing to something more invasive.
How Composite Bonding Can Transform Your Smile
One of the biggest advantages of bonding is how quickly you see changes.
If you want to improve your smile with composite bonding, even small adjustments can make your teeth look straighter, brighter, and more balanced.
Here’s what bonding can improve:
- Minor chips or cracks
- Gaps between teeth
- Worn or uneven edges
- Discolouration that whitening can’t fix
- Slight shape or size mismatches
A skilled dentist blends the resin to match your natural enamel, so the final look is smooth and seamless.

How Long Does Composite Bonding Last?
Bonding can last several years with good oral habits. Brushing, flossing, minimising staining foods, and avoiding habits like nail biting all help preserve the resin so your smile stays polished.
Your dentist will also check the bonded areas during routine visits to keep everything in good shape.

FAQs
1. Does bonding hurt?
No, bonding is painless because it doesn’t require drilling or numbing in most cases.
2. How long does bonding take?
Most appointments last 30–60 minutes per tooth, depending on the changes you want.
3. Will bonding look natural?
Yes, the resin is colour-matched to your natural enamel, so it blends seamlessly.
4. Can bonding fix gaps?
Small gaps can often be closed or reduced with bonding for a more even smile.
